In this episode of Star Wars: Galactic Pals, Miree searches for a playful Loth-cat hiding in the grass.

Star Wars: Galactic Pals is here to add some fun to our creature features.

Although its original run has come to a close, the great team at Star Wars Kids has added to the adventures of the Galactic Pals. The series launched at the start of the year and featured a fun new look at the creatures of the galaxy far, far away. Every critter from the humble Ewok to the adorable Wookiee was showcased to kids of all ages in a fun new way. And what’s more, the series also boasted its own toy line which is still flying off the shelves as we speak.

But today, the team behind the series has expanded the adventures by adding the Gungans and Loth-Cats to the series. So, join us as we head back to Lothal in search of those adorable little Tooka’s.

MATTEL PLUSH

As mentioned above, Mattel Plush is bringing the Galactic Pals to life in a brand new line of Plush Toys. These will include a Wookiee, an Ewok, a Jawa, a Rodian, and more. And they are all readily available at Target now. What’s more, Mattel has confirmed that they are expanding the line by adding a brand new Ewok. Check out our first look below.

Star Wars Galactic Pals will have a 12-episode run, with the first six released every Tuesday through April 26.
